Prescriptivist schoolteachers and old-school etiquette experts, for example, have, like, totally … masshealth lienWebSep 26, 2024 · Pause fillers are expressions designed to give the speaker a bit of thinking time in normal conversation, presentations, or speaking exams. They are a useful way to buy your brain a little thinking time and are present in most languages.
